This dataset provides the foundational data supporting the methodological validation presented in the article "Low-Code Tool for Phytosociological Data Management and Analysis: Application of the Point-Centered Quarter Method via AppSheet". The repository includes three primary files: Raw Field Collection Matrix (Levantamento pontos quadrantes.csv): Contains raw data collected in the field using the Point-Centered Quarter Method (PCQM), including taxonomic identification, point-to-plant distances, and individualized circumference at breast height (CBH) for multiple stems. Processed Calculation Matrices (fitossociologia.csv): Displays the automated aggregation and calculation of structural descriptors, such as the Importance Value Index (IVI), including relative density, frequency, and dominance. Ecological Indices Summary (Resumo indices.csv): Provides a synthesis of alpha-diversity metrics, including Species Richness (S), Shannon-Wiener Index (H′), and Pielou’s Equitability (J′), both for the total community and segmented by subcommunities (Area 1, Area 2, and Area 3). These data allow for the verification of the system's logic and the replicability of the comparative analyses and sampling sufficiency monitoring (Species Accumulation Curve) discussed in the study. The architecture demonstrates how a low-code platform can effectively eliminate manual transcription bottlenecks while maintaining taxonomic precision and data integrit.
